mysql
-
mysql中limit的使用方法
LIMIT用于限制查询返回的行数,基本语法为LIMIT N获取前N条记录;通过LIMIT offset, count实现分页,如LIMIT 10, 5表示跳过前10条取5条;常与ORDER BY配合确保顺序;推荐使用LIMIT count OFFSET offset提升可读性;注意大偏移量可能引发性…
-
蓝屏报错:内核数据入页错误
今天为大家分享解决kernel data inpage error蓝屏问题的实用方法,步骤清晰简单,快来了解如何快速修复系统异常。 1、 开机过程中按下F8键,进入安全模式。 2、 使用快捷键Windows+E打开文件资源管理器,然后进入控制面板。 3、 在控制面板中,点击“系统与安全”选项。 4、…
-
mysql外连接查询如何理解
左外连接保留左表全部记录,右表无匹配则填NULL;右外连接反之。例如查询所有用户及订单(含未下单用户)用LEFT JOIN,关注所有订单(含异常)可用RIGHT JOIN。内连接仅返回匹配行,外连接保留主表全量数据。 MySQL外连接查询用于返回两个表中的匹配行,同时保留其中一个表中不满足连接条件的…
-
mysql中default的使用
DEFAULT用于设置列的默认值,插入时若未指定该列则自动填充;2. 支持常量、CURRENT_TIMESTAMP等表达式(MySQL 8.0+支持更复杂表达式);3. 可在INSERT或UPDATE中使用DEFAULT关键字强制应用默认值;4. TEXT/BLOB类型不可设默认值,NOT NULL…
-
mysql中foreign key的使用注意
在MySQL中使用外键需确保表均使用InnoDB引擎,外键与引用列数据类型兼容且被引用列有索引,合理设置级联操作并命名约束,注意性能影响与锁问题,必要时可临时关闭外键检查以提升批量操作效率。 在MySQL中使用外键(FOREIGN KEY)可以有效维护表之间的数据完整性,但在实际应用中需要注意多个关…
-
mysql instr条件查询的实现
INSTR函数用于查找子字符串在主字符串中首次出现的位置,返回从1开始的整数,未找到则返回0。其语法为INSTR(str, substr),常用于WHERE条件中实现模糊匹%ign%ignore_a_1%re_a_1%,如SELECT * FROM users WHERE INSTR(name, &…
-
如何快速更新Microsoft Office
当microsoft office无法正常兼容某些文档时,建议掌握正确的软件获取与安装方法,确保文档能够顺利打开和编辑,从而提高工作效率。 1、 双击桌面的Word快捷方式,启动Microsoft Word应用程序。 2、 点击左上角“开始”按钮,从菜单中选择Word程序以打开应用。 3、 进入界面…
-
mysql中unique和primary key的区别
主键(PRIMARY KEY)唯一且非空,每表仅一个,自动创建聚集索引;唯一约束(UNIQUE)可有多个,允许一个NULL值,创建二级索引,用于保证列值唯一性。 在MySQL中,UNIQUE 和 PRIMARY KEY 都用于保证列(或列组合)中的数据唯一性,但它们有几个关键区别,理解这些差异有助于…
-
mysql中有哪些常见的原则
数据库设计应遵循前三范式以减少冗余和依赖,必要时适度反范式化;2. 合理创建索引提升查询效率,遵循最左前缀原则并避免过度索引;3. SQL编写需简洁高效,避免SELECT *、函数操作导致索引失效,并控制事务大小;4. 通过EXPLAIN分析执行计划,避免全表扫描,结合慢查询日志优化性能;5. 高并…
-
mysql列的使用规范
答案:MySQL列设计应选择合适数据类型,合理设置属性,规范命名,并考虑索引优化。需根据业务选最小够用类型,如TINYINT、VARCHAR、DATETIME等;设NOT NULL并配默认值,统一用utf8mb4字符集;命名小写加下划线,主键用id,外键与引用列同名;高频查询字段建索引,遵循最左匹配…